"Revolutionary War Records, Volume 1, Virginia" by Gaius Marcus
Brumbaugh, 1936 states on page 134:
"Mahon, John, Lieutenant, Continental Line, appears to have been
in service as lieutenant from Jan.1,1777 to Sept. 23,1778 a year
and nearly nine months, there is no proof of his title to bounty
land"
John Mahan is also listed in "A List of Non-commissioned
officiers and Soldiers of the Virginia Line" 1835, page 82 (Doc.
N.44)
John Mahan is also listed on several applications to the
Daughters of the American Revolution. One of those applications
was by Phalabelle Romer Martin. Another was by Gloria Newman
Audd.

"William had married Maud, the daughter of Sir John
Fitz-Geoffrey whose lands were concentrated in Surrey and Essex,
and was the widow of Sir Gerard de Furnivalle. Furnivalle died
in 1261, and it would appear likely that she had married Earl
William by the time of his accession as earl; their son Guy is
described as ‘30 or more’ in 1301, placing his birth in 1271,
and there is no reason at all to suppose that he was among the
first born of William and Maud's seven children. In fact it
would make sense for Maud to have married William soon after the
death of her first husband, well before the succession to the
Warwick inheritance had been determined. McFarlane refers to the
Fitz-Geoffrey as a ‘very minor baronial house’, and it would
seem likely that this marriage was at least arranged before the
succession of the earldom of Warwick had been properly secured.
The notion, sometimes put forward, that William married Maud for
financial gain can also be dismissed. Maud is frequently
referred to as an heiress; indeed she was one of four
co-heiresses to the Fitz-Geoffrey estates after her brother died
without issue in 1297. However it is most unlikely that this
chance windfall had been a factor in the arrangement of their
marriage thirty years previously.
Whatever the circumstances of the marriage, Earl William was
clearly fond of his wife. Judging by his will, William does seem
to have possessed a sentimental side; he requests that if he
should die oversees, his heart be removed from his body and
buried wherever his wife (‘his dear consort’) should choose to
have herself interred, and their surviving son Guy was present
when she was buried next to her husband. She certainly seems to
have suffered from a disabling infirmity toward the end of her
life which made travel impossible, but this does not appear to
have been a hindrance earlier on, for they had seven children
that we are aware of."
